Frequently Asked Questions

How much does "Living Sanctuary Pre-School" charge per month?

Living Sanctuary Pre-School's monthly fees are not publicly listed on this page, so it is best to contact them directly for current rates. As a general guide, preschool and kindergarten fees in Singapore typically range from around S$160 per month at government-supported anchor operator centres to over S$2,000 at private operators, depending on programme type, hours, and subsidies applied. Beyond the monthly fee, families should ask about a one-off registration fee, a deposit (commonly equivalent to one to two months' fees), as well as uniform and insurance charges. Childcare and kindergarten fees are GST-exempt, so no GST should be added to your invoice. See the full childcare cost guide for Singapore →

What subsidies can I claim at "Living Sanctuary Pre-School"?

Singapore citizen children enrolled at ECDA-licensed childcare centres may be eligible for the Basic Subsidy — up to S$600 per month for infant care and up to S$300 per month for childcare. Working mothers employed for at least 56 hours per month may additionally qualify for the Working Mother's Child Care Subsidy (WMCCS). For lower-income families, the Additional Subsidy can bring combined monthly support up to S$710 or more, subject to per capita household income. For kindergarten programmes, the KiFAS scheme provides means-tested fee assistance to eligible Singapore citizen families. Permanent resident children may qualify for partial subsidies at lower quantum. Subsidy amounts and eligibility criteria are reviewed periodically, so it is advisable to check directly with ECDA at www.ecda.gov.sg for the most current figures before enrolment. Is there a waitlist at "Living Sanctuary Pre-School"?

Popular preschools and kindergartens in Singapore, particularly those with strong reputations or convenient locations, can have waiting lists of several months. It is generally advisable to enquire at least three to six months ahead of your intended start date, and up to twelve months ahead for infant care vacancies. January is the peak intake month for most preschools, so families targeting a start at the beginning of the school year should begin enquiries no later than mid-year. Once a suitable slot is identified, a registration fee and deposit are typically required to secure the place.
